Joseph Sebastian Widagdo Vehicle routing decision making is the problem that is usually faced by distributors in determining the best routes to deliver or collect goods. By using a good route, the company can save transportation cost drastically. It is considered as a complex problem because in real world problems, vehicle routing considers many things, such as time windows, types of vehicles, congestion, time-dependent, and so many more. In mathematical modelling terms, it is considered as a NP hard problem, which requires heuristic algorithm to obtain a good solution within a reasonable computation time.
